The counting of votes for the West Bengal panchayat elections is underway, and the Trinamool Congress (TMC) is currently leading in a majority of seats. As of 00:36:55 PST on July 11, 2023, the TMC is leading in 445 out of 63,229 gram panchayat seats, 833 out of 9,730 panchayat samiti seats, and 189 out of 928 zilla parishad seats.

live updates

 

The BJP is a distant second, trailing the TMC in all three tiers of panchayats. The Congress is also trailing, but it is making some gains in the zilla parishad elections.

The counting of votes is being held amid tight security, as there were some incidents of violence during the polling. The State Election Commission (SEC) has said that it will take stern action against those responsible for the violence.
